 18kt Gold 1961 Accutron 214 

 Click on the thumbnails for larger images and then use your "back" button to return 

                   

This lovely watch has been cleaned and serviced. It is otherwise in as-found condition.
Occasionally, I acquire a 214 that is just too nice to mess with, and this is definitely one of them.
 


         

The bezel has been lightly polished, leaving the crisp edges intact.
 
The inside surfaces of the lugs are undamaged.
 
The hands are excellent.

The dial is excellent.

The original M1(1961) nickel plated movement is in excellent condition.

The crystal is new.


The back cover, setting stem, and battery hatch have been lightly polished.

The stainless steel threaded lock ring has been buffed.

The engraving reads: "BULOVA" - "18K" - "WATERPROOF" - "PATENTED" - "D11110" - "M1".

The engraving is crisp, and the watch is not personalized.


         


The lightly used brown 1960's Bulova band is marked "Genuine Alligator Lizard".
The tuning fork logo buckle is marked "Bulova" - 1/20 10K G.F.

This watch will fit up to an 8 inch circumference wrist.
 


    

The original case, like the watch, is in near-new condition.
Few owners kept the original outer cardboard box, and most of the ones that were saved are in lousy condition, but this one is about an 8 on a scale of 10 (10 being new).  

This handsome timepiece has been fully serviced. The movement has been ultrasonically cleaned, lubricated, and adjusted to work perfectly and keep accurate time with a readily available #387S or #394 1.5v silver oxide battery.
